IceRocket's RSS Builder
IceRocket, the very Googlesque browser which counts Mark Cuban as an investor, has launched an RSS service called RSS Builder.

Although it took me a minute to figure out what the point was (and I'm still not 100% sure), I think I know what they're offering. RSS Builder allows you to create a custom RSS feed item by item and then publish it to your website.

So, you could add that item you saw on Slashdot, then something you saw on Engadget and something else you saw on sMoRTy71. RSS Builder will generate a new feed that allows you to serve us those random items in your own feed.

While it is cool that they are offering a free service, it makes me wonder why you wouldn't just create a del.icio.us account and use the RSS feed that comes along with that to accomplish the same thing. Seems like that would be easier to do. However, if you are one of those people that prefers to do things the hard way, then RSS Builder beats the crap out of del.icio.us.
